InvoiceInk Runbook — Account Recovery

New folks: if the renderer's service account gets locked (usually after a bad cert rotation), PDFs silently stop generating and billing gets cranky fast. Don't panic. Pause the render queue, check the cert expiry in the Opaline dashboard, then kick off account recovery from the admin shell. When prompted, enter the recovery passphrase shown just below.

vault phrase of tajeg-tageg = pelix-druix-holius-briael-zorwyn-frawyn-fraox-norok-drueth-aldiel

## Changelog — Font vendoring defaults changed

As of this release, the Bracken UI build no longer fetches third-party fonts at build time. All typefaces used by the Lanternwell suite are now vendored into the repo under a dedicated assets directory, and the fetch step is skipped by default. If you're onboarding, nothing to install — the fonts travel with the checkout. The build flags controlling this behavior are listed below.

settings of hadup-yafog:
LAMAEL_PIN=3761
LAMAEL_TENANT=istmir
LAMAEL_METRICS_HOST=metrics.lamael.plorvasys.test
LAMAEL_SEAL=seal_8ea68500
LAMAEL_STANDBY_TEAM=fraok

**Q: What happens if Keyturner fails mid-rotation?**

Keyturner, our internal secrets-rotation utility, writes a checkpoint before each rotation step. If a run aborts, do not re-run blindly — first roll back to the checkpoint from the Keyturner console so downstream services keep valid credentials. The rollback command prompts for the checkpoint recovery passphrase, which is recorded on the following line.

unlock words, yahif-yajef: kasok-julax-norael-gorael-istox-normir-istael